About This Item

(ELLIS ISLAND). Pamphlet. Early 1900s. The First Touch at America’s Gateway, a pamphlet about Ellis Island complied by missionary leader and author Frances M. Schuyler. The pamphlet was published by the Woman’s American Baptist Home Mission Society, a Chicago-based society of female missionaries who served immigrants and impoverished Americans, including African and Native Americans. Schuyler was an officer, and she details the mission’s efforts at Ellis Island in the pamphlet. It is in very good condition with light soiling.
